Description
This building is a shippon located approximately 80 metres to the north of Lower Lea Farmhouse. It dates from the mid to late 19th century. The structure features a rubble plinth and end walls, with weatherboarded timber frame upper parts and a plain tile roof. It consists of four framed bays and is one storey high, with a loft in the eastern bay. There are two boarded loft doors and a boarded door to the north, as well as a low boarded door to the south. Inside, the shippon has machine-cut king post trusses and staggered double purlins.
